The fuel pump inertia switch for a 1997 Ford Escort is located inside the trunk immediately below the hole in the trunk side trim. (according to the owner's manual)
On a 1999 Ford Escort , depending on model , the fuel pump shut off switch ( inertia switch ) is in the passenger side of the trunk , behind the trunk liner ( there is an access hole ) or in the drivers footwell , behind the kick panel ( there is an access hole )
On a 2000 Ford Explorer : The fuel pump shut off switch ( inertia switch ) is located in the front passenger footwell , by the kick panel

The fuel pump shut off switch, on the 1998 Ford Escort is located : coupe - right side of trunk behind the trunk liner ( access hole or plug ? ) sedan or wagon - driver's footwell, behind the kick panel According to the diagrams in the owner's manual
